Some Examples of Active and Passive Voice Sentences and the Conversion. To gain a better understanding of the distinction between active and passive voice, let’s go through some examples. Active Voice: Mark manages the entire assembly line in the factory. Passive Voice: The entire assembly line in the factory is managed by Mark.

Active voice means that the subject of the sentence is performing the verb’s action. For example, “The cat climbed the tree.”. Passive voice means that the subject of the sentence is acted on by the verb: “The cat was rescued by a fireman.”. In today’s fast-paced world, many individua...May 17, 2023 · Here’s an example of this with the subject underlined: Subject performing the action (active voice): The dog chased me. Subject receiving the action (passive voice): I was chased by the dog. It’s the dog that’s doing the chasing, so our canine is the subject of the sentence. You can find the subject by asking who or what did the action. The passive-active vocabulary ratio was lower for the older group (73% as opposed to 89%), indicating an increase in the gap between 370 Language Learning Vol. 48, No. 3 the two vocabularies. Because the two groups of learners were similar on all variables except the amount of instruction, Laufer attributed their differences to the additional ...

Move the passive sentence's subject into the active sentence's direct object slot. 2. Remove the auxiliary verb be from the main verb and change main verb's form if needed. 3. Place the passive sentence's object of the preposition by into the subject slot.
